How to Harden Clay Faster

Are you looking for the perfect summer craft for your kids? Maybe you are a teacher and need a afternoon craft that can be made at home and easily assembled by your kids at school? If so, making clay can often be done overnight and can turn into beautiful creations made by children and adults.

Difficulty: Easy
Instructions

Things You'll Need:

  • 4 tbsp of white glue
  • 4 tbsp of cornstarch
  • 2 tsp of lemon juice
  • 2 tbsp of acrylic paint (use any color you like)
  • 2 tbsp of cold cream
  • Large bowl
  • Plastic spoon

    Making Quick Clay

  1. Step 1

    Mix all the ingredients in a large bowl. Knead for at least five minutes. Wash hands.

  2. Step 2

    Use your hands or a plastic spoon to form figures out of the clay mixture. If too dry add a bit of water.

  3. Step 3

    Spread aluminum foil on a cookie sheet. Place the clay figures on the sheet and cook for at least one hour at 350 degrees.

Tips & Warnings
  • Give children ideas of what how they can design the clay. Some ideas are shapes, people and funny designs.
